The experience is well worth the trip and time. Joel is very knowledgeable and entertaining, and the caves themselves are filled with history. The stories are quite interesting, and one of the most impressive elements is standing in a section of the cave, seeing it with your own eyes, and looking at a picture of the same exact spot from 50-100 years ago. It makes the experience relatable in a way that most cave crawls cannot. The graffiti (things etched into the sand with fingers/etc.) is actually more of an attraction than a detraction, in that it fills the view with the wonder of years. One, barely legible at this point, is signed with a date in the 1800s. We purchased Joels book, but havent read it yet--though looking forward to doing so. It is filled with pictures and stories surrounding the history of the Robbers Cave. Joel was quick to respond to questions in email, easy to arrange a tour time, and quite friendly. The tour is not long, the cave easy to traverse, we didnt need a jacket, and pictures are both welcomed and encouraged. This isnt a cave crawl so much as a journey through recent history in a cave, but I still recommend it to those looking to wander a cave. This tour touches a little of both in a way that your typical cave-crawl cannot.
